About Gold. 1 cubic meter of Gold weighs 19 320 kilograms [kg] 1 cubic foot of Gold weighs 1 206.1082 pounds [lbs] Gold weighs 19.32 gram per cubic centimeter or 19 320 kilogram per cubic meter, i.e. density of gold is equal to 19 320 kg/m³; at 20°C (68°F or 293.15K) at standard atmospheric pressure .
